Growing beauty for generations. Otto & Sons roses and plant material can be found in landscapes from Las Vegas to Malibu and San Francisco to San Diego. We are known throughout this region for our immense selection of roses with over 120,000 plants and just north of 800 varieties each year. We also provide a diverse and comprehensive selection of fruit trees and berries. These include many kinds o

f stone fruit, apples, citrus, avocados, cherries and berries. We even carry eight varieties of blueberries specially bred for the warm Southern California climate. Our full selection of roses, fruit trees, berries, and general landscape plants are available at our growing ground in Fillmore, California year round. We are open to the public Wednesday through Saturday 8 am to 5 pm; please call for seasonal hours. We also supply numerous independent retail garden centers and landscapers throughout the region. We were established in 1976 and have been in Fillmore at 1835 E. Guiberson Road since 1978. With over 40 years in the business we strive to offer the best selection and the highest quality plant material all ready to make your yard the best it has ever been.
